Painting Description
"General Arthur St. Clair" is a portrait painting by Charles Willson Peale, an American painter known for his portraits of leading figures of the American Revolution. The painting is a depiction of Arthur St. Clair, a Scottish-American soldier and politician who served as a Major General in the Continental Army during the American Revolutionary War and was later the President of the Continental Congress. The portrait is a significant historical document, capturing the likeness of a notable figure from the early years of the United States.
Charles Willson Peale, born in 1741, was a prolific portraitist who painted many of the era's most influential leaders, including George Washington, Benjamin Franklin, and Thomas Jefferson. Peale's work is characterized by its attention to detail, realism, and the ability to convey the personalities and stature of his subjects. His portraits are often celebrated for their historical value and artistic merit, contributing to the visual record of the nation's founding generation.
The painting of General Arthur St. Clair is executed in Peale's signature style, with careful attention to the subject's attire and surroundings, which reflect his military and political status. The artwork serves not only as a tribute to General St. Clair's service but also as an example of early American portraiture and the emerging cultural identity of the United States.
As a historical artifact, "General Arthur St. Clair" by Charles Willson Peale holds a place in the collection of American portraiture and is of interest to historians, art historians, and the general public for its representation of an important figure in American history and its embodiment of the artistic qualities of the period. The painting is a testament to Peale's skill as an artist and his role in documenting the visages of America's founding fathers.
